[#7161] ld-scripts/empty-aligned in linux-uclibc test fails

Document created by Aaronwu Employee on Oct 17, 2013
Version 1Show Document
  • View in full screen mode

[#7161] ld-scripts/empty-aligned in linux-uclibc test fails

Submitted By: Mingquan Pan

Open Date

2012-06-15 03:04:32     Close Date

2012-06-28 05:40:32

Priority:

Medium     Assignee:

Stuart Henderson

Board:

STAMP     Silicon Revision:

Resolution:

Duplicate     Fixed In Release:

N/A

Processor:

BF533     

Host Operating System:

toolchain rev.:

    kernel rev.:

State:

Closed     Found In Release:

N/A

Is this bug repeatable?:

N/A     

Summary: ld-scripts/empty-aligned in linux-uclibc test fails

Details:

 

ld-scripts/empty-aligned in linux-uclinux fails.

 

Running /home/test/work/cruise/checkouts/toolchain/binutils-2.21/ld/testsuite/ld-scripts/empty-aligned.exp ...

bfin-linux-uclibc-as    -o tmpdir/dump0.o /home/test/work/cruise/checkouts/toolchain/binutils-2.21/ld/testsuite/ld-scripts/empty-aligned.s

Executing on host: sh -c {bfin-linux-uclibc-as    -o tmpdir/dump0.o /home/test/work/cruise/checkouts/toolchain/binutils-2.21/ld/testsuite/ld-scripts/empty-aligned.s 2>&1}  /dev/null ld.tmp (timeout = 300)

spawn [open ...]^M

bfin-linux-uclibc-ld  -L/home/test/work/cruise/checkouts/toolchain/binutils-2.21/ld/testsuite/ld-scripts  -T empty-aligned.t -o tmpdir/dump tmpdir/dump0.o

Executing on host: sh -c {bfin-linux-uclibc-ld  -L/home/test/work/cruise/checkouts/toolchain/binutils-2.21/ld/testsuite/ld-scripts  -T empty-aligned.t -o tmpdir/dump tmpdir/dump0.o  2>&1}  /dev/null ld.tmp (timeout = 300)

spawn [open ...]^M

bfin-linux-uclibc-readelf  -l --wide tmpdir/dump > tmpdir/dump.out

Executing on host: sh -c {bfin-linux-uclibc-readelf  -l --wide tmpdir/dump > tmpdir/dump.out 2>ld.tmp}  /dev/null  (timeout = 300)

spawn [open ...]^M

regexp_diff match failure

regexp "^ Section to Segment mapping:$"

line   "  GNU_STACK      0x000000 0x00000000 0x00000000 0x00000 0x20000 RWE 0x8"

regexp_diff match failure

regexp "^ +Segment Sections\.\.\.$"

line   " Section to Segment mapping:"

regexp_diff match failure

regexp "^ +00 +.text $"

line   "  Segment Sections..."

extra lines in tmpdir/dump.out starting with "^   00     .text $"

EOF from /home/test/work/cruise/checkouts/toolchain/binutils-2.21/ld/testsuite/ld-scripts/empty-aligned.d

FAIL: ld-scripts/empty-aligned

 

Follow-ups

 

--- Stuart Henderson                                         2012-06-28 06:41:08

This is also covered by:

[#6124] Some ld tests fail for section error with bfin-linux-uclibc

 

 

 

    Files

    Changes

    Commits

    Dependencies

    Duplicates

    Associations

    Tags

 

File Name     File Type     File Size     Posted By

No Files Were Found

Attachments

    Outcomes